5. ElevenLabs Launches Grant Program

To support startups and solopreneuers in the AI space, ElevenLabs has launched a grant program that will give selected recipients up to 11 million tokens to use on voice synthesis. What crazy ideas will people come up with for this?

4. Meta AI Election Rules

Meta continues to expand its AI election rules. It will turn off all social and political ads the week before the elections, and even before that, any ads using generative AI will need to have full disclosure. Still, expect this to be a wild year in political advertising...

3. Google Calls for Pro-Innovation Rules in Contentious EU AI Act Process

The process to get the EU AI Act over the finish line is being complicated by questions around how to regulate foundation models. Google's chief legal officer this week echoed calls from other tech labs that rules should be pro-innovation, and that getting rules right was more important than getting them first.

2. Is Pika 1.0 AI Video's ChatGPT Moment?

Just a week after Stability AI announced Stable Video Diffusion, Pika has announced Series A funding and Pika 1.0, which brings some seriously impressive capabilities to text-to-video. So much so that some are calling it AI video's "ChatGPT moment."

1. Amazon Announces Q Chatbot and AI Chips

At their annual re:Invent event, AWS made a few big AI announcements. We didn't get the massive rumored "Olympus" model, but we did get the "Q" chatbot aimed at the enterprise, as well as the latest generation of AI custom chips. For now, the race to catch GPT-4 continues.
